No. 19 Polar Bears drop Fightin’ Quakers in 3

ADA – The Wilmington College volleyball team fell to No. 19 Ohio Northern University in straight sets Wednesday evening 25-8, 25-11, 25-21 in Ohio Athletic Conference action.

The Fightin’ Quakers showed a little spunk in the third set, taking a 13-10 lead thanks to a kill from Karrah Wind and an ONU service error. The hosts answered before kills from Wind and Jillian Wesco gave the Quakers a 15-14 edge.

That lead would be the last lead Wilmington would have, however, as the Polar Bears won four consecutive points and never looked back.

Ohio Northern finished the match with 41 kills and just nine attack errors for a .348 hitting percentage while Wilmington put down 22 kills compared to 20 errors and a .021 hitting percentage.

Wesco and Wind both had six kills for the Quakers while Mariella Szrom added five. Wesco also led Wilmington’s back row with eight digs while Jacie Koontz dished out 11 assists.

Wilmington dips to 5-16 overall and 0-4 in the OAC with the loss. ONU improves to 14-4 and 4-1 in conference play with the win.

The Quakers return home for a tri-match with Marietta College and Ohio University-Chillicothe Saturday.
